My latest food adventure has been Green Smoothies. I can admit it has an ominous sound...I mean who would want their fruity drink to be green?!? Well count me in...I am addicted! These treats can be made in the blender and are really good for you. The general recipe is 40% greens and 60% fruit. They taste like Jamba or like V-8 Splash with extra fiber...but not creepy grainy fiber. Just yummy. I encourage you to try one....heck, I will even make it for you!
